Description Location: Joliet, IL (Onsite) Employment Type: Full-Time MUST SPEAK SPANISH We are seeking an AI Inventory Support Specialist to develop, deploy, and support AI-powered solutions that improve inventory operations and business processes. This is a hands-on technical role for someone who is passionate about AI automation, full-stack development, and rapidly deploying production-ready solutions. This is not an entry-level position. Candidates must have real-world experience building and deploying AI applications and automations. What You'll Do • Design, build, and deploy AI-powered tools that improve inventory and operational workflows. • Develop AI automations, agents, and integrations using modern AI platforms. • Work with business stakeholders to identify manual processes and replace them with AI-driven solutions. • Build and maintain full-stack applications that integrate AI models into business operations. • Test, troubleshoot, and continuously improve deployed AI solutions. • Stay current with emerging AI technologies and recommend new tools and capabilities. Requirements Required Qualifications • Minimum 1 year of hands-on experience building and deploying AI automation solutions (no entry-level candidates). •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field. • Full-stack development experience strongly preferred. • Demonstrated proficiency with Claude, OpenAI Codex, GitHub Copilot , and other leading AI development tools. • Experience deploying AI applications into production environments. • Strong programming and problem-solving skills. • Ability to work onsite in Joliet, IL area. Preferred Qualifications • Experience building AI agents, AI workflows, and automation pipelines. • Familiarity with modern development frameworks, APIs, and cloud deployment. • Experience using AI-assisted coding tools to accelerate software development. • Passion for learning and adopting emerging AI technologies.
